<a style="color:#487DAE;" href="javascript:export_orderlist();">导出订单</a>
今天测试提一个bug。所在360浏览器下面一个订单导出功能无效。
接到问题,找测试重现。360浏览器果然无效。使用ie6浏览器又出现了。但是ie7,8,9和firefox都是好的。
猜想应该是ie6浏览器的问题。
查找代码。发现到处功能这样实现的:
<a style="color:#487DAE;" href="javascript:" onclick="export_orderlist();“>导出订单</a>
既有href又有onclick。修改成
功能正常使用。
但是本人不喜欢把方法都写道href里面。看看是不是有其他的方式实现。继续修改,测试。
<a style="color:#487DAE;" href="javascript:void(0);" onclick="export_orderlist();">导出订单</a>功能没有实现。。。
<a style="color:#487DAE;" href="javascript:void(0);" onclick="export_orderlist();return false;">导出订单</a>
可以了。。。
以后要注意:超链接会先执行onclick事件然后才是href属性的相关操作。
转载地址:http://www.cnblogs.com/ainiaa/archive/2011/11/22/2259332.html
相关推荐
在上面的代码中,我们创建了一个ClickSpan对象,覆盖了onClick方法,当用户点击超链接时会启动一个浏览器Activity打开链接。然后通过indexOf方法找到超链接在字符串中的位置,使用setSpan方法将ClickSpan应用到指定...
不过,这种方法对于IE6浏览器可能不完全有效,因为`return false`不会阻止链接的默认行为,所以推荐使用`javascript:void(0)`。 3. 明确指定`javascript:`前缀: 另一种方法是在`onclick`事件处理函数中显式使用`...
此外,在解决问题时,用户也可以尝试重建 OL 配置档或者重建用户本地帐户文件,但是这两种方法可能无法解决问题,因为它们不能解决系统性错误。如果用户想要解决问题,需要更改系统设置工具的配置,或者卸载浏览器...
解决EXCEL超链接图片用网页打开设置方法
本文将分析超链接中文乱码问题的成因和解决方法。 问题分析 在 HTML 超链接中,当我们需要将中文参数作为 GET 请求的参数时,直接拼接中文参数到 URL 上可能会导致乱码。例如,在一个超链接 URL 中,我们需要将...
解决方法是在Action中添加一个成员变量,保存编码后的中文参数。在vm页面渲染时取出这个变量值,再拼接超链接。 在这里碰到的问题是:调用java.net.URLEncoder的encode()方法时,如果没有显示指定字符集参数,那么...
chrome点击链接启动ie浏览器方法,包括浏览器启动即自动全屏脚本
超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!...
解决EXCEL超链接图片用网页打开设置方法
本文实例讲述了javascript处理a标签超链接默认事件的方法。分享给大家供大家参考。具体分析如下: 有时需要在a标签上添加click事件,并且跳转前处理一些事务,故需要做一些处理;通常前端会给出一个<a>link来代表这个...
这里的`setHtml()`方法用于设置文本框的内容,`<a>`标签定义了一个超链接。`setOpenLinks(true)`使得用户点击链接时可以触发相应的事件。 为了响应超链接的点击,我们需要连接`QTextEdit`的`linkActivated()`信号到...
以下是如何在C1FlexGrid控件中实现超链接的方法。 首先,为了设置超链接样式,你需要创建一个新的CellStyle,并设置其Font属性为带有下划线的字体,ForeColor属性为蓝色,这样看起来就像一个标准的超链接。在`c1...
EXCEL 超级链接被禁止的解决方法 在 Excel 表格中,...Excel 超级链接被禁止的解决方法是多方面的,我们需要了解系统权限、IE 的设置和注册表的修改等知识点。只有掌握了这些知识点,我们才能更好地解决这个问题。
标题"IE6完美解决PNG背景透明"指向的是如何在IE6中正确显示具有透明度的PNG背景图像的方法。DD_belatedPNG是一个JavaScript库,专门用来解决这个兼容性问题。它通过CSS扩展和JavaScript代码,使IE6能够理解并渲染PNG...
这可以通过ECharts的`on`方法来实现: ```javascript myChart.on('click', function (params) { if (params.componentType === 'geo') { // 获取点击的省份名称 var province = params.name; // 根据省份名称...
超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!超链接引用无效。 错误!...
然而,在IE6中,如果使用`onclick`事件处理函数并包含`return false;`语句,可能会阻止`window.location.href`的执行。这是因为`return false;`会阻止事件的默认行为,例如在超链接上点击时的默认跳转行为。在上面的...
### jsp超链接中文乱码的解决方法 在开发基于JSP(Java Server Pages)的Web应用程序时,可能会遇到一个常见的问题:超链接中的中文字符显示为乱码。这一问题通常发生在用户尝试通过包含中文字符的URL进行页面跳转...
JavaScript 禁止超链接跳转的方法 #### 1. JavaScript 禁止超链接跳转的方法简介 JavaScript 禁止超链接跳转的方法是指通过 JavaScript 代码来阻止超链接的默认跳转行为,达到某些特定的目的。在 Web 开发中,经常...